Transaction 321244ea05eb0c2d3706932772686342528be462bdba08be71afb58997abf7b0

1 Input
2 Outputs
  • 321244ea05eb0c2d3706932772686342528be462bdba08be71afb58997abf7b0:0
  • value  514550
    address  17P3cKkbHv4PTN11RB5hqxNptPXm95vj5b
  • 321244ea05eb0c2d3706932772686342528be462bdba08be71afb58997abf7b0:1
  • value  6541696
    address  1N5EVfKQJUidc1KgSbCSmwXjPzFQrtFdXN